Art History Lecture – Watteau and Hopper – “Game of Pairs Dreamworks” by Ronnie Ireland

This lecture compares and contrasts two seemingly very different paintings – “Embarkation for Cythera” (1717) by Antoine Watteau and “New York Movie” (1939) by Edward Hopper. Seemingly worlds apart, there are fascinating correspondences and contrasts when you look more deeply. In turn we learn more about the artists and the societies in which they worked.
